Output e3fa7af48892e0454bf9fa3b55ca86acf95f492277cff5aae0ae6ac77cfc7e93:0

value
290778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8513dd1ce2ba948ab3b2ad54d1c230e214e41d2a OP_EQUAL
address
3DpfbDJ7chkarfbnmd1a4FqBdBX69NJdHz
transaction
e3fa7af48892e0454bf9fa3b55ca86acf95f492277cff5aae0ae6ac77cfc7e93